    I'm nervous what do I do? I had sex last night and the condom popped?

    should i go try get one of the Plan B pills..or after-morning pill?
    How does that work? Do i just go to a clinic and ask for one?

    what are the effects of it? I work from morning until night and don't have a lot of time..I have never taken one of those pills before and know nothing of it..

    You have 72 hours to take the pill for it to be effective. You can get them at a pharmacy with photo ID if you are over 18. It costs about $35. It is a short series of pills and it will have different effects on your body. Most women experience very heavy bleeding and an irregular period for a month. It is considered very safe. It works by blocking any potentially fertilized eggs from implanting in the uterine lining, therefore preventing pregnancy.

    I think you can get them at the pharmacy now, if you are over 18. You need to go ASAP to get them cause you have 72 hours and the sooner the more effective. I think it is 2 pills but it comes with instructions on how to take. I have had to before due to condoms breaking and they worked.

    Go and get the morning after pill. It costs about $30 in australia, don't know how much other places.

    It's available over the counter here. It's two little pills, taken some time apart. The newer ones don't have too many side effects. Better safe than sorry.

    This can affect your normal cycle, so don't panic if your period is a little late, or if you start your period early.
